Primary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Provide strategic workforce planning expertise to the US Intelligence Community (IC) with a focus on workforce modernization and mobility.
  • Develop and implement with IC partners career path roadmaps for specific IC professions; re-evaluate roadmaps as needed.
  • Develop methods to formalize professions and identify measures to track progress of these efforts.
  • Organize and facilitate interagency community of practice quarterly meetings.
  • Create competency models and identify developmental or training activities by proficiency level.
  • Collaborate with IC subject matter experts and working groups on human capital priorities.
  • Develop workforce upskilling strategies.
  • Refine and update content in IC-wide competencies library.
  • Consult on best practices in workforce analysis.
  • Advise IC agencies on human capital policy, the workforce of the future, and other long-term goals.
  • Conduct data-driven research and analysis.
  • Minimum Qualifications:

  • Requires a TS/SCI with Polygraph.
  • Requires a BS/BA with 18+ years, a MS/MA with 10+ years, or no degree and 24+ years of experience.
  • Experience developing core and leadership competency models.
  • Experience conducting skills-gap analysis and developing upskilling strategies.
  • Experience planning and implementing career paths.
  • Strategic workforce planning experience.
  • Expertise related to advancing foundational competencies in AI within workforce(s).
  • Desired Qualifications:

  • Human resource process improvement experience.
  • Previous experience leading communities of practice and/or working groups.
  • Strategic communications.
